Skip to content

Instantly share code, notes, and snippets.

@ravichandrae
Created August 2, 2015 02:52
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save ravichandrae/5b8e7c2f9110623053ea to your computer and use it in GitHub Desktop.
Save ravichandrae/5b8e7c2f9110623053ea to your computer and use it in GitHub Desktop.
def containsNearbyDuplicate(nums, k):
index_map = {}
for i in range(len(nums)):
if nums[i] in index_map:
if i - index_map[nums[i]] > k:
index_map[nums[i]] = i
else:
return True
else:
index_map[nums[i]] = i
return False
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ment